Are Himars rockets guided?
The HIMARS carries one launch pod containing either six Guided MLRS (GMLRS)/MLRS rockets or one Army Tactical Missile System (ATACMS) missile. HIMARS is designed to support joint early and forced entry expeditionary operations with high-volume destructive, suppressive and counter-battery fires.

What does MLRS fire?
Guided Multiple Launch Rocket System (GMLRS) is a surface-to-surface system used to attack, neutralize, suppress and destroy targets using indirect precision fires up to 70-plus km. GMLRS munitions have greater accuracy than ballistic rockets with a higher probability of kill and a reduced logistics footprint.
Where are GMLRS rockets made?
The GMLRS AW is 90% common with the Unitary variant. By September 2016, Lockheed Martin had produced more than 25,000 GMLRS rockets at its facility in Camden, Arkansas. GMLRS Production Forecast:
